Summary of the comparison

Faldingworth Community Primary School and The Middle Rasen Primary School are primary schools in Market Rasen.

  • Faldingworth Community Primary School scores 55 out of 100 (grade C, average) and The Middle Rasen Primary School scores 53 out of 100 (grade D, below average). Faldingworth Community Primary School is ahead on our composite score.

  • Faldingworth Community Primary School was judged Good and The Middle Rasen Primary School was judged Good.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 43.0% for Faldingworth Community Primary School and 62.0% for The Middle Rasen Primary School.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has fallen at Faldingworth Community Primary School (50.0% in 2022-23, 43.0% in 2024-25) and has risen at The Middle Rasen Primary School (58.0% in 2022-23, 62.0% in 2024-25).
